The Student Conservation Association (SCA) is the largest provider of hands-on environmental conservation programs for youth and adults. Program participants protect and restore national parks, marine sanctuaries, cultural landmarks, and community green spaces across the country.

Hours will include office, field, and classroom-based interpretation and education work. Tasks will include creation and production of written and/or print materials, such as site bulletins and website content; drafting of social media posts; interpreting the park’s cultural and natural resources for visitors through informal contacts and formal programming; development of lesson plans and other educational materials that meet Texas and national curriculum standards; creation and production of virtual programming; presentation of distance-learning and/or in-classroom education programs; and a variety of related visitor services tasks.
